If those are Windows PCs be aware that the network profile for the zt interface in the firewall is usually defaults to public. This also assumes that “Core Networking Diagnostics - ICMP Echo Request” is enabled in the firewall.

However, if you wan’t ZeroTeri LAN communcations the same principle as points 1 and 2 still applies. Thus, if you want B and others on the ZeroTier network to be able to communcate to all nodes on the 192.128.1 LAN than add the following route to you main router:

“route add 10.147.17.0/24 dest 192.168.1.10”

And as AndrewZ pointed out, the PI is a good candiadate to run zt on.

Btw, Packet Forwarding must to be enabled on the zt-node acting as a zt router. If running Windows have a look at: “Ping other system out of ZeroTier IP
